MILTON, Mass. - A three-goal third period helped the Salve Regina University women's ice hockey team overcome a 2-1 deficit to defeat Curry College 4-2 in Commonwealth Coast Conference (CCC) action Friday evening.
INSIDE THE MATCHUP
Final: Salve Regina 4, Curry 2
Records: SRU (4-5, 1-4 CCC), CC (3-4-2, 1-2-2)
THREE STARS:
- Salve Regina senior Maddie Cox netted the game-winner at 16:16 of the third.
- Salve Regina freshman Samantha McKenzie tied the game 2-2 at 8:33 of the third.
- Salve Regina senior Emily Wagner sealed the victory with an empty-net goal at 19:28.
NOTEWORTHY:
- Salve Regina outscored the Colonels 3-0 in the third period.
- Salve Regina outshot Curry 24-18.
- Ellee Kopecky made 16 saves for the Seahawks to improve to 2-4 on the season.
- Anna Langton stoped 20 shots for the Colonels to fall to 1-1-1 between the pipes.
